* WHAT…Light freezing drizzle and light snow in far northeast
Alabama and southern middle Tennessee. A light glaze of ice
accumulation and additional dusting of snowfall is expected.
Precipitation will end by Midnight.
* WHERE…North Alabama and a portion of southern middle Tennessee.
* WHEN…Until midnight CST tonight.
* IMPACTS…Roads, and especially bridges and overpasses, will
likely become slick and hazardous.
* ADDITIONAL DETAILS…With temperatures falling to or below
freezing tonight, refreezing of melted snow or ice is expected
which may form black ice on area roadways.
